The lowest payment is $25 a month; you can also choose payments of $35, $48 or $150 per month. There’s a nonrefundable ... How much does Bill Self make a year? Self is guaranteed $5.41M per season with a base salary of $225,000, $2.8M in professional services, and an annual retention bonus of $2.44M.
